Data Analytics, in my opinion and experience, is basically the ability to extract important information from data, in hopes of getting some insights on how the present and the future looks like. Why is the concept of data analytics so important Today?

The truth is, data is changing how everything works. Especially in the business world. I believe there is not one single way to explain this correctly to you. But I will use examples to get my point to you. I believe that will work. Data helps business companies and individuals know the patterns and trends in consumer behavior, so that they know what exactly the market requires. Data is helping the medics understand the trends and patterns in various diseases and symptoms, so that they can come up with better treatments for specific diseases. It is therefore why, the person who knows how to use their data well Today, wins in their field. And it’s with that reason that I love to say, data is not the future, as most people say.

Data is the present

Every business owner Today, whether micro or macro, has to understand the concept of data analytics. And how it is important to running their business. It is the only way to stay competitive and competent in your field. Your marketing will be more profitable when you know the data you have in your hands. Your production will be influenced by the data you have. Is your product still relevant to the consumer? What has to be changed and what is not?

From that angle therefore, there are going to be two key players in the data world; the people who need the information from data, and the people who actually analyze the data. I will call the people who need information the company or business owner. And I will call the person that analyzes the data the data analyst (I leave all the other synonyms to you).
